What type of tuning, specifically, do you want? Another Harman-ish tuned IEM, very neutral, a lot of bass? What technicalities? Ultra detailed, a lot of upper treble air? I can name a few, and mostly they are just different from the Starfield, and not definitively better, in that price range.

- JVC FDX1/FD01 - somewhat neutral, with pronounced upper mids. Very customizable. Highly detailed and resolving, especially for a single DD.
- ThieAudio Legacy 3 - Harman-ish, well balanced, smooth, detailed enough. Just a very enjoyable listen. My current fav.
- Tri i3 - tribrid technology, with a planar driver.
- BQEYZ Spring 1 (Spring 2 expected soon) - tribrid technology, with a piezoelectric driver.
